'''WRRC''' is an American ([[FM Broadcasting|FM]]) [[radio station]] licensed by the [[Federal Communications Commission|FCC]] to serve the community of [[Lawrenceville, New Jersey]] on the frequency of 107.7 [[Megahertz|MHz]] . The station license is assigned to Board Of Trustees Of Rider College. WRRC-FM) airs a [[Educational]] format.
The [[FCC]] first licensed this station to begin operations on February 27, 1984 using callsign WRRC.
The station has held the WRRC callsign since May 21, 1991.<ref name="fcccsh">{{cite web |title=Call Sign History|url= http://licensing.fcc.gov/cgi-bin/ws.exe/prod/cdbs/pubacc/prod/call_hist.pl?Facility_id=6109&Callsign=WRRC
